EckyEcky said: Heading down this Tuesday, have to pick a carrier, BVI Digicel or BVI Lime. Is one better than the other? Thanks! EckyEcky Who is your stateside carrier? Roaming plans just keep getting better and better. AT&T and Verizon have $10 a day plans that give you exactly what you already have in the states. T Mobil is free roaming. I do not see the upside in wasting valuable vacation time tilting at windmills with cell phone companies.

cwoody said:Winterstale said: I used the $10 a day plan from my AT&T and it worked great while I was down last month. That's weird. We have verizon and I used the $10 day plan without issue last summer. If I remember correctly, the phone initially hooked me into CCT Boatphone, which was pretty much garbage, but once I manually switched to digicell no problem and I was able to stream music everywhere all week.
